As a part of the Indo-European language family and originally writing in runic alphabet,Old Norse gave rise to many present languages, such as Icelandic, Faroese, Norwegian, Danish, and Swedish. Together with various dialects, Old Norse was used in many regions, including present territories of Scandinavian countries, Scotland, Ireland, England, Wales, Isle of Man, Normandy and Vinland.
